Due to the popularity in streaming services and six-year anniversary of "Runaway" in 2021, Aurora released a series of compilation EPs that contained her released songs at the time. The track was later included as the lead single of her debut album All My Demons Greeting Me as a Friend, released in 2016. On 7 February 2015 the song was released worldwide as the lead single of her debut EP Running with the Wolves. The demo of the song was produced by Magnus Skylstad and became available on the By:larm website in late 2013. She began writing the song between the ages of 11 and 12, and created the melody on the piano she had at her home, which took an hour approximately. Aurora included the song on the setlist of her All My Demons Tour (2016).Īurora wrote most of the songs of her debut album, including "Runaway" at a young age. It features Aurora walking through various landscapes of Bergen while singing the song. An accompanying music video for the song on June 26, 2017, and directed by Kenny McCracken. The song has been certified gold in the United States, Italy, and Portugal by the Recording Industry Association of America (RIAA), Federation of the Italian Music Industry (FIMI), and Portuguese Phonographic Association (AFP), respectively. The song also charted in various countries, including the United Kingdom, Australia, Norway, Germany, and Ireland. Although "Runaway" did not enter the US Billboard Hot 100, it peaked at number one on the US Bubbling Under Hot 100 chart for 2 weeks. In 2021, the song went viral on the video-sharing platform TikTok, resulting in new chart successes and streams on various platforms. "Runaway" received positive reviews from music critics who praised its lyricism and musical style.

The track's lyrics express escaping reality and realizing the need to return home. "Runaway" is a downtempo folktronica, synth-pop, electronic, and electropop song with influences from Nordic folk music that was compared to the works of Florence Welch and Joni Mitchell. The song was written by Aurora with Magnus Skylstad and produced by the latter with Odd Martin Skålnes. It was released on 7 February 2015 through Glassnote Records. " Runaway" is a song by Norwegian singer Aurora released as the first and lead single of both her debut extended play (EP) Running with the Wolves (2015) and debut album All My Demons Greeting Me as a Friend (2016).
